Core Functions of the Mercedes A-Class Key
A Mercedes A-Class key is more than just a tool for locking and opening doors. It houses a number of "concealed" or secondary functions created to enhance benefit and security.
1. Worldwide Opening and Closing
By pointing the key fob at the infrared sensor situated on the motorist's door handle and holding the "unlock" button, the chauffeur can automatically roll down all windows and open the sunroof. Alternatively, holding the "lock" button will close all windows. This is particularly beneficial for venting heat out of the cabin on a summer season day before getting in the vehicle.
2. The Emergency Mechanical Blade
Concealed within every electronic Mercedes key is a physical metal blade. If the key fob battery dies or the automobile's main battery fails, this blade can be extracted to by hand unlock the motorist's door. To discover it, one must move a small release catch on the back or bottom of the fob and pull the metal piece out.
3. Keyless-Go and Keyless-Start
On newer A-Class models, the key uses proximity sensing units. As long as the key is in a pocket or bag, the chauffeur can touch the door deal with to open the car and press the "Start/Stop" button on the control panel to fire up the engine.
4. Battery Deactivation (Sleep Mode)
For W177 designs, Mercedes introduced a security function to prevent signal increasing by thieves. By double-clicking the "lock" button on the fob, the Keyless-Go function is temporarily shut off, and the key goes into a "sleep mode." This likewise substantially extends the life of the fob's battery.
Upkeep: Battery Replacement and Care
The most common problem owners deal with is a depleted key fob battery. When the battery begins to stop working, the car might display a message on the instrument cluster stating, "Replace Key Battery," or the variety of the remote may dramatically decrease.

Even with high-end German engineering, technical glitches can occur. Understanding how to detect these issues can save a vehicle owner money and time.
"Key Not Detected"
If a motorist enters the car and tries to begin it but gets a "Key Not Detected" error, it may not always suggest the key is broken.
Disturbance: Electronic devices (like mobile phones) or high-voltage power lines can disrupt the signal.The Backup Slot: On the A-Class, there is typically a designated area in the center console or where the ignition barrel used to be. Putting the key in this specific location enables the car to read the transponder chip even if the fob battery is dead.Physical Damage
The buttons on the A-Class key are developed for durability, however the rubber or plastic can ultimately wear down or crack. Moisture is the main opponent of the internal circuit board. If a key is dropped in water, it is recommended to eliminate the battery instantly and permit the system to dry out in a bowl of silica gel or rice.

Security Practices for A-Class Owners
To protect versus contemporary car theft techniques, such as relay attacks where thieves magnify the signal from a key inside a home to unlock a parking area outside, numerous precautions are encouraged:
Use Faraday Bags: These pouches are lined with metallic material that blocks all radio frequency signals.Use Sleep Mode: As mentioned previously, double-clicking the lock button on newer keys disables the transmitter.Range: Keeping keys at least 15 to 20 feet away from the outside walls of the home can make it harder for burglars to obstruct the signal.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
